Home
last modified time | relevance | path

Searched refs:dma_request_channel (Results 1 – 63 of 63) sorted by relevance

/linux-4.1.27/Documentation/crypto/
Dasync-tx-api.txt181 be shared. For these cases the dma_request_channel() interface is
185 struct dma_chan *dma_request_channel(dma_cap_mask_t mask,
193 dma_request_channel simply returns the first channel that satisfies the
199 be the return value from dma_request_channel. A channel allocated via
206 private. Alternatively, it is set when dma_request_channel() finds an
/linux-4.1.27/drivers/dma/sh/
Dshdma-of.c36 chan = dma_request_channel(mask, shdma_chan_filter, in shdma_of_xlate()
Dusb-dmac.c663 chan = dma_request_channel(mask, usb_dmac_chan_filter, dma_spec); in usb_dmac_of_xlate()
Drcar-dmac.c1460 chan = dma_request_channel(mask, rcar_dmac_chan_filter, dma_spec); in rcar_dmac_of_xlate()
/linux-4.1.27/drivers/spi/
Dspi-dw-mid.c66 dws->rxchan = dma_request_channel(mask, mid_spi_dma_chan_filter, rx); in mid_spi_dma_init()
73 dws->txchan = dma_request_channel(mask, mid_spi_dma_chan_filter, tx); in mid_spi_dma_init()
Dspi-ep93xx.c814 espi->dma_rx = dma_request_channel(mask, ep93xx_spi_dma_filter, in ep93xx_spi_setup_dma()
825 espi->dma_tx = dma_request_channel(mask, ep93xx_spi_dma_filter, in ep93xx_spi_setup_dma()
Dspi-davinci.c810 dspi->dma_rx = dma_request_channel(mask, edma_filter_fn, in davinci_spi_request_dma()
818 dspi->dma_tx = dma_request_channel(mask, edma_filter_fn, in davinci_spi_request_dma()
Dspi-topcliff-pch.c882 chan = dma_request_channel(mask, pch_spi_filter, param); in pch_spi_request_dma()
897 chan = dma_request_channel(mask, pch_spi_filter, param); in pch_spi_request_dma()
Dspi-pl022.c1134 pl022->dma_rx_channel = dma_request_channel(mask, in pl022_dma_probe()
1142 pl022->dma_tx_channel = dma_request_channel(mask, in pl022_dma_probe()
/linux-4.1.27/Documentation/dmaengine/
Dclient.txt25 To request a channel dma_request_channel() API is used.
28 struct dma_chan *dma_request_channel(dma_cap_mask_t mask,
38 When the optional 'filter_fn' parameter is NULL, dma_request_channel()
Dprovider.txt249 dma_request_channel or dma_release_channel for the first/last
/linux-4.1.27/drivers/misc/mic/host/
Dmic_device.h205 chan = dma_request_channel(mask, mdev->ops->dma_filter, in mic_request_dma_chan()
/linux-4.1.27/drivers/dma/
Dof-dma.c222 return dma_request_channel(info->dma_cap, info->filter_fn, in of_dma_simple_xlate()
Dacpi-dma.c454 return dma_request_channel(info->dma_cap, info->filter_fn, dma_spec); in acpi_dma_simple_xlate()
Dmmp_tdma.c613 return dma_request_channel(mask, mmp_tdma_filter_fn, &param); in mmp_tdma_xlate()
Ddma-jz4780.c718 return dma_request_channel(mask, jz4780_dma_filter_fn, &data); in jz4780_of_dma_xlate()
Dmxs-dma.c768 return dma_request_channel(mask, mxs_dma_filter_fn, &param); in mxs_dma_xlate()
Ddmatest.c848 chan = dma_request_channel(mask, filter, params); in request_channels()
Dcppi41.c879 return dma_request_channel(info->dma_cap, info->filter_fn, in cppi41_dma_xlate()
Dimx-dma.c1046 return dma_request_channel(imxdma->dma_device.cap_mask, in imxdma_xlate()
Dimx-sdma.c1448 return dma_request_channel(mask, sdma_filter_fn, &data); in sdma_xlate()
Dat_hdmac.c1513 chan = dma_request_channel(mask, at_dma_filter, atslave); in at_dma_xlate()
Dcoh901318.c1805 return dma_request_channel(cap, coh901318_filter_base_and_id, &args); in coh901318_xlate()
Dste_dma40.c2409 return dma_request_channel(cap, stedma40_filter, &cfg); in d40_xlate()
/linux-4.1.27/drivers/soc/tegra/fuse/
Dfuse-tegra20.c110 apb_dma_chan = dma_request_channel(mask, NULL, NULL); in apb_dma_init()
/linux-4.1.27/sound/core/
Dpcm_dmaengine.c279 return dma_request_channel(mask, filter_fn, filter_data); in snd_dmaengine_pcm_request_channel()
/linux-4.1.27/drivers/dma/dw/
Dplatform.c58 return dma_request_channel(cap, dw_dma_filter, &slave); in dw_dma_of_xlate()
/linux-4.1.27/drivers/ata/
Dpata_ep93xx.c664 drv_data->dma_rx_channel = dma_request_channel(mask, in ep93xx_pata_dma_init()
672 drv_data->dma_tx_channel = dma_request_channel(mask, in ep93xx_pata_dma_init()
Dsata_dwc_460ex.c863 hsdevp->chan = dma_request_channel(mask, sata_dwc_dma_filter, hsdevp); in sata_dwc_port_start()
/linux-4.1.27/sound/soc/fsl/
Dfsl_asrc_dma.c218 pair->dma_chan[dir] = dma_request_channel(mask, filter, &pair->dma_data); in fsl_asrc_dma_hw_params()
/linux-4.1.27/drivers/usb/musb/
Dux500_dma.c332 dma_request_channel(mask, in ux500_dma_controller_start()
/linux-4.1.27/sound/soc/txx9/
Dtxx9aclc.c361 dmadata->dma_chan = dma_request_channel(mask, filter, dmadata); in txx9aclc_dma_init()
/linux-4.1.27/drivers/mtd/nand/
Dfsmc_nand.c1040 host->read_dma_chan = dma_request_channel(mask, filter, in fsmc_nand_probe()
1046 host->write_dma_chan = dma_request_channel(mask, filter, in fsmc_nand_probe()
Dsh_flctl.c153 flctl->chan_fifo0_tx = dma_request_channel(mask, shdma_chan_filter, in flctl_setup_dma()
169 flctl->chan_fifo0_rx = dma_request_channel(mask, shdma_chan_filter, in flctl_setup_dma()
Dlpc32xx_mlc.c578 host->dma_chan = dma_request_channel(mask, host->pdata->dma_filter, in lpc32xx_dma_setup()
Dlpc32xx_slc.c712 host->dma_chan = dma_request_channel(mask, host->pdata->dma_filter, in lpc32xx_nand_dma_setup()
Domap2.c1747 info->dma = dma_request_channel(mask, omap_dma_filter_fn, &sig); in omap_nand_probe()
Datmel_nand.c2216 host->dma_chan = dma_request_channel(mask, NULL, NULL); in atmel_nand_probe()
/linux-4.1.27/drivers/mmc/host/
Djz4740_mmc.c181 host->dma_tx = dma_request_channel(mask, NULL, host); in jz4740_mmc_acquire_dma_channels()
187 host->dma_rx = dma_request_channel(mask, NULL, host); in jz4740_mmc_acquire_dma_channels()
Dmxcmmc.c1140 host->dma = dma_request_channel(mask, filter, host); in mxcmci_probe()
Datmel-mci.c2295 host->dma.chan = dma_request_channel(mask, pdata->dma_filter, in atmci_configure_dma()
/linux-4.1.27/sound/atmel/
Dac97c.c1057 chip->dma.rx_chan = dma_request_channel(mask, filter, in atmel_ac97c_probe()
1086 chip->dma.tx_chan = dma_request_channel(mask, filter, in atmel_ac97c_probe()
Dabdac.c479 dac->dma.chan = dma_request_channel(mask, filter, &pdata->dws); in atmel_abdac_probe()
/linux-4.1.27/drivers/net/ethernet/micrel/
Dks8842.c939 tx_ctl->chan = dma_request_channel(mask, ks8842_dma_filter_fn, in ks8842_alloc_dma_bufs()
962 rx_ctl->chan = dma_request_channel(mask, ks8842_dma_filter_fn, in ks8842_alloc_dma_bufs()
/linux-4.1.27/sound/soc/sh/rcar/
Ddma.c155 dmaen->chan = dma_request_channel(mask, shdma_chan_filter, in rsnd_dmaen_init()
/linux-4.1.27/drivers/usb/renesas_usbhs/
Dfifo.c1230 fifo->tx_chan = dma_request_channel(mask, usbhsf_dma_filter, in usbhsf_dma_init_pdev()
1235 fifo->rx_chan = dma_request_channel(mask, usbhsf_dma_filter, in usbhsf_dma_init_pdev()
/linux-4.1.27/sound/soc/sh/
Dsiu_pcm.c370 siu_stream->chan = dma_request_channel(mask, filter, param); in siu_pcm_open()
/linux-4.1.27/include/linux/
Ddmaengine.h1089 #define dma_request_channel(mask, x, y) __dma_request_channel(&(mask), x, y) macro
/linux-4.1.27/drivers/crypto/ux500/cryp/
Dcryp_core.c495 dma_request_channel(device_data->dma.mask, in cryp_dma_setup_channel()
501 dma_request_channel(device_data->dma.mask, in cryp_dma_setup_channel()
/linux-4.1.27/Documentation/acpi/
Denumeration.txt99 return dma_request_channel(cap, filter_func, &args);
/linux-4.1.27/drivers/media/platform/
Dtimblogiw.c669 fh->chan = dma_request_channel(mask, timblogiw_dma_filter_fn, in timblogiw_open()
Dm2m-deinterlace.c1013 pcdev->dma_chan = dma_request_channel(mask, NULL, pcdev); in deinterlace_probe()
/linux-4.1.27/drivers/misc/carma/
Dcarma-fpga-program.c1029 priv->chan = dma_request_channel(mask, dma_filter, NULL); in fpga_of_probe()
Dcarma-fpga.c1402 priv->chan = dma_request_channel(mask, dma_filter, NULL); in data_of_probe()
/linux-4.1.27/drivers/net/irda/
Dsa1100_ir.c127 buf->chan = dma_request_channel(m, sa11x0_dma_filter_fn, (void *)name); in sa1100_irda_dma_request()
/linux-4.1.27/drivers/tty/serial/
Dpch_uart.c749 chan = dma_request_channel(mask, filter, param); in pch_request_dma()
763 chan = dma_request_channel(mask, filter, param); in pch_request_dma()
Damba-pl011.c301 chan = dma_request_channel(mask, plat->dma_filter, in pl011_dma_probe()
319 chan = dma_request_channel(mask, plat->dma_filter, plat->dma_rx_param); in pl011_dma_probe()
Dsh-sci.c1678 chan = dma_request_channel(mask, filter, param); in sci_request_dma()
1707 chan = dma_request_channel(mask, filter, param); in sci_request_dma()
/linux-4.1.27/sound/soc/intel/common/
Dsst-firmware.c228 dma->ch = dma_request_channel(mask, dma_chan_filter, dsp); in sst_dsp_dma_get_channel()
/linux-4.1.27/drivers/media/platform/soc_camera/
Dmx3_camera.c770 chan = dma_request_channel(mask, chan_filter, &rq); in acquire_dma_channel()
/linux-4.1.27/drivers/rapidio/
Drio.c1531 return dma_request_channel(mask, rio_chan_filter, mport); in rio_request_mport_dma()
/linux-4.1.27/drivers/crypto/ux500/hash/
Dhash_core.c137 dma_request_channel(device_data->dma.mask, in hash_dma_setup_channel()
/linux-4.1.27/drivers/video/fbdev/
Dmx3fb.c1600 chan = dma_request_channel(mask, chan_filter, &rq); in mx3fb_probe()